Field strengths from fixed transmitters, such as base stations for radio
(cellular/cordless) telephones and land mobile radios, amateur radio,
AM and FM radio broadcast and TV broadcast cannot be predicted
theoretically with accuracy. To assess the electromagnetic environment
due to fixed RF transmitters, an electromagnetic site survey should be
considered. If the measured field strength in the location in which the
Model Number or Type Number - by manufacturer is used exceeds
the applicable RF compliance level above, the Model Number or Type
Number - by manufacturer should be observed to verify normal operation.
If abnormal performance is observed, additional measures may be
necessary, such as reorienting or relocating the Model Number or Type
Number - by manufacturer.
Over the frequency range 150 kHz to 80 MHz, field strengths should be
less than [Vi] V/m.

The Model Number or Type Number - by manufacturer is intended for
use in an electromagnetic environment in which radiated RF disturbances
are controlled. The customer or the user of the Model Number or Type
Number - by manufacturer can help prevent electromagnetic interference
by maintaining a minimum distance between portable and mobile RF
communications equipment (transmitters) and the Model Number or Type
Number - by manufacturer as recommended below, according to the
maximum output power of the communications equipment.
